Rise of Tag Team Dynamics

Recent events in the wrestling world, such as AEW Collision 2025, highlight the pivotal role of tag teams. The Don Callis Family, featuring Konosuke Takeshita and Kyle Fletcher, triumphed over Powerhouse Hobbs and Tomohiro Ishii, showcasing how teamwork, strategy, and synchronization continue to redefine wrestling matches. Tag teams add complexity with their unique match dynamics and often provide platforms for storytelling.

Star Power and Rising Contenders

Evolution in wrestling includes emerging stars like Mark Briscoe, who effortlessly defeated the controversial Max Caster. This match emphasized Briscoe’s potential as a formidable contender, challenging the status quo and highlighting the importance of securing crowd favorites.

The Era of Backstage Politics and Alliances

The storyline between CRU, Top Flight, and AR Fox at AEW Collision underscores the intricate web of backstage politics. Alliances form and dissolve, echoing the dynamic narrative evolution reminiscent of classic wrestling rivalries.
